Output d93652300ca03a7f74a34cd4e4e02020179e0ae6d0cae4454b251d5224d9c2da:0

value
1862751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043703c63bfd44d2c94cbecce23bcef5614dc8fa OP_EQUAL
address
M8HSqgujNa7heXmFLKrBA7d8DXU5srNb8d
transaction
d93652300ca03a7f74a34cd4e4e02020179e0ae6d0cae4454b251d5224d9c2da
spent
true